One of the 2025 Fantasy football busts the model is predicting: Chiefs running back Isiah Pacheco. A seventh-round pick in the 2022 NFL Draft, Pacheco quickly earned Andy Reid's trust with his hard-charging running style, and wound up leading Kansas City in rushing in 2022 and 2023. However, he's coming off an injury-plagued season in 2024 and there are other issues with his game as well.

His 17.9% route participation ranked 54th among NFL running backs in 2024 and his 8.4% juke rate ranked 55th. That lack of reliability as a receiver and an inability to make tacklers miss led to the Chiefs favoring Kareem Hunt down the stretch last season. Hunt is back to vy for touches and the organization also signed Elijah Mitchell and drafted Brashard Smith this offseason. Those are all big reasons why the model ranks Pacheco as its RB40 despite the fact that he's the 26th running back off the board on average in early 2025 Fantasy football drafts.

Another bust that SportsLine's Fantasy football rankings 2025 have identified: Chargers quarterback Justin Herbert. The former Oregon star burst onto the NFL scene, throwing for 4,336 yards and 31 touchdowns as a rookie in 2020. He then elevated his game in his second year, surpassing 5,000 passing yards and throwing 38 touchdowns. However, since then, his Fantasy production has dropped notably, especially now that he's operating in a run-heavy offense under head coach Jim Harbaugh.

In 2024, Herbert completed 65.9% of his passes for 3,870 yards and 23 touchdowns, ranking as the 13th best quarterback in Fantasy during his first season with offensive coordinator Greg Roman. He hasn't ranked among the top-10 Fantasy QBs in the last three seasons, and the model expects that pattern to persist.
